- Beschrijving
- Epiphytic shrub on base of treetrunk, growing in low, densely stemmed Elfin forest, very rich in lichens,mosses and epiphytes. The thick woody basal part up to 1 cm. in diam. Stems up to 1 m. long. Leaves rather thick fleshy somewhat glossy green above, also glossy but much paler and with prominent red brown midrib beneath. Stipules long, persistent. Male flower: Tepals 4. Outer bigger tepals obovate, 5x3 mm., wine-red with white edge all around. Inner tepals oblanceolate, 5x1.5 mm., wine red with white edge on top. Stamens ca. 15, anthers yellow, pressed against each other. Young fruits wine-red, with pale lenticel-like spot terete.
